Problem of Good
How can an all-loving and all-just and all-powerful God who makes all things
from nothing let evil entice us so well to do bad things and why do the innocent
suffer terrible diseases and so on?
Clearly even if God is not responsible for causing evil he is responsible for
controlling it. He tolerates it and that tolerance is a matter of
responsibility. Religion says he is responsible but he is not responsible in the
sense that you can judge him immoral for allowing it. He did not make evil for
evil is just good going wrong.
So God stomachs evil. Religion then talks about the problem of evil.
The assumption is that evil does not show there is no God but we need to show
that God can tolerate evil and remain good.
This is special pleading for it assumes, "No evil is bad enough to refute God
because there is a God and we can show there may be a God for no evil is bad
enough."
No evil is big enough in damage and no evil is intolerable in itself. That
amounts to saying evil is not really evil. If evil is bad enough in itself it
does not matter if what follows is terrible or reasonably okay. What is
intolerable is intolerable even if good follows. It should not follow but that
is not the point.
To use a trick like special pleading when there is so much harm and pain and
evil is itself evil.
Some religions claim that this can be avoided. They say that to call evil evil
is to assume that there is a God who opposes it totally though he lets it
happen. So they say that if there is no God you cannot have a problem of evil
for evil is not really evil.
If you cannot understand or make sense of evil then you cannot understand or
make sense of good either.
They say that if there is no God then we cannot explain or understand what good
is. They call this the problem of good.
Believers say evil is only a problem BECAUSE God is good. So to dismiss belief
in God because of evil means you create worse problems. You have a problem of
good. They say that you still have a problem of evil but that contradicts how
they say that if you reject God over the problem of evil then you end up with no
problem of evil.
They say that if you drop God then you cannot really believe in good. We need
good to be able to identify evil. They say that the problem of good is strong
evidence for the existence of God and rescues the doctrine from those who think
believers are only guessing that a loving God can let evil happen.
The accusation is that if you deny that evil in some way is that bad and
intolerable or if you deny that God is good then you are shirking the problem.
You don't want a solution.
But that is a cruel accusation against the sincere atheist. Believers say that
because God is about opposition to evil it follows that to say there is no God
because evil exists is to refuse to work with the one thing that can do
something about evil. The implication is that the atheist waters down evil by
rejecting God paradoxically because of evil. The problem of good is an actual
assault on the integrity of the atheist and if the atheist is indeed undermining
goodness without realising it then he or she is still bad news.

EVIL – AN ARGUMENT FOR THE EXISTENCE OF GOD?
If it is true that evil is just a form of good and God is goodness, then it
follows that instead of disproving God or making him unlikely to exist, evil
proves God's existence.
Atheists usually argue that an all-good and all-powerful God does not exist
because there is evil and suffering. The Church contends that this argument
makes no sense for to recognise that evil exists is to say that there is a
divine standard which is based on good and a side-effect of being good is being
opposed to evil. So God and the notion that there is good and there is evil go
together. Evil then is an argument for God's existence.

ATHEIST HAS NO PROBLEM OF GOOD
The believer in God says the atheist will have a problem of good. That is
nonsense. The atheist recognises that if there is no God and no anything then it
is good that there is nobody to suffer. Good is a default.
A If there is nothing there is no innocent person to suffer. Take that by
itself. That is good.
B If there is nothing there is nobody to lie or steal cookies. Take that by
itself. That is good.
Imagine you have to choose one or the other. A is the obvious choice. This means
that a good God cannot allow suffering. Atheism is vindicated. God implies that
we should choose B for God is about things such as being honest.
